Reading Incentive/Fundraiser

The kids(all 4 of them) are working on a fundraiser/reading incentive program for coop right now. They are asking for sponsors and they will read for 300 minutes over the next two weeks. (30 minutes a day for 10 days) The program is sponsored through Usborne Books. The kids will earn 50% of the money they raise in books which they pick out of the big catalog. Since as homeschoolers, the moms are the teacher, I will get to choose 30% of what they each raise in books as well. ( This will be used to get curriculum books.) Finally, our coop will get the remainder 20% of what they raise in cash to help with different needs in our coop. If you would like to sponsor the kids, please email me and let me know.
